A19 Testo's Junction Improvement Scheme (Flyover)

South Tyneside, UK · 2019–2021 · £124.5 million (total scheme cost); £130 million (reported by NCE)

Key engineering challenges

Raising the A19 over an existing roundabout to create a flyover. - Installation of a large, heavy bridge structure. - Maintaining traffic flow on a busy A-road during construction. - Integrating new local road connections and public rights of way.
